To solve this riddle, first we have to put it into an algebraic expression, letting the variable n represent the unknown number we are looking for.
1/5n - 5 = n + 1/3
Next, we have to add 5 to both sides, to cancel out the -5 on the left side of the equation.
1/5n = n + 5 1/3
Then, we have to subtract n from both sides of the equation to cancel out the positive n on the right side of the equation.
-4/5n = 5 1/3
Finally, we have to divide both sides by -4/5 in order to get our variable n alone on the left side by canceling out its coefficient.
n = - 6 2/3
Therefore, the number in Aiden's riddle is -6 2/3 or -20/3.
